CRPF Asst Commandant, a resident of Uri in north Kashmir dies in Jharkhand

Date:


Ranchi: An Assistant Commandant of the Central Reserve Police Force (CRPF) has died in Khunti district, a senior police officer said on Tuesday.

“CRPFs Assistant Commandant Ghulam Jilani Khan died of unknown reasons on Monday. We have sent the body for post mortem to know about the details (of the death),” Deputy Inspector General of Police, A V Homkar told PTI. Khan is a resident of Boniyar, in northern Kashmir’s Uri.

Details could be known only after the post mortem report comes, he said when asked the reason behind the death. (PTI)
